Want To Know More About College? Read This Piece There's a lot more to college than just the next step following high school. It is where the entire world opens up to you, and you have many important, life-altering decisions to make. Careful planning goes a long way toward setting yourself up to succeed and thrive. Always take some water to class with you. You have to remain hydrated to ensure your brain and body are functioning properly. If you have little or no downtime between classes, this is an absolute must. If you drink water, you will be able to stay on top of your classes. You can even refill your bottle at a water fountain. Maintain a healthy diet. The term "freshman 15" exists for a reason. Make sure you're aware of the foods you're consuming. Try not to eat too many on the go foods like pizza or fast food. It might seem fast and cheap but adds up over time and doesn't provide you with the energy a nutritious meal would. You should involve yourself with on campus activities. Also, activities can help to bolster you resume for future work. Keep a balanced approach. Work out at the campus gym as much as you can. Here, you'll be able to meet others that are active in your school while you also keep yourself fit. You can find a group of friends who will go to the gym with you on a regular basis. High school is much different from college, as you will need to start all over. College is much different and many things you accomplished in high school won't matter to people you encounter in college. Try new things and push yourself to succeed. Interning is a great activity for college students. This lets you see your potential career from the inside out. If you'd like for your internship to result in an actual job offering, make certain that you fully apply yourself and learn everything that there is to know regarding your particular position. Most schools have an available department that will assist in locating intership opportunities. Apply for an internship when you're going to college. An internship gives you a chance to experience what life can be like after you graduate from college. A good internship may even lead to a job opportunity further down the road. The college you're in should have a place that helps you get an internship, so get on it! Catch the local transportation to your classes. You'll likely discover that you won't spend much longer going to class by the bus. You save time because you are not looking for parking. You no longer have to pay for gasoline or parking passes.
